Healthy eating tips for busy families
With the endless juggle of school drop-offs and pick-ups, work, after school sports, extra-curricular activities, committee meetings and play dates, today’s families are busier than ever.
Leading by example and ensuring your family eats a balanced diet is key to feeling healthy, happy and strong. Here are some quick tips to help your whole family stay on track with your healthy eating routine.
1. Keep it simple. Family meals don’t have to be elaborate to be healthy and effective! Come up with easy ways to balance your meal with simple vegetable side dishes or fruit and yogurt for dessert.
2. Have healthy food on hand and eat from your freezer or pantry on busy weeknights.
3. Prepare double batches of food when you’re less rushed so you can cook once, eat twice.
4. Family meal does not have to be dinner, breakfast or lunch may work better in some households.
5. Turn off technology and make conversation the focus of family meals. Catch up on the day with everyone, share fun stories and jokes, talk about news events etc.
6. Share the work. Enlist help from the family, from planning the shopping list to making lunches, setting the table, pouring the milk and clean up. Eating as a family is truly comforting, from toddlers, teens to adults. Family meals can become a memorable tradition for the whole family.
7. Dump the guilt. Family meals may not happen every day, and that’s ok. Make the most of your family meals when they occur.
